본문 바로가기
카테고리 없음

[오라클] 이미 존재하는 테이블의 컬럼 추가, 컬럼명 수정, 컬럼 자료형 수정, 컬럼 삭제하기

by 서피 2021. 3. 11.

예시를 위해 사용할 테이블을 생성한다.

create table member_table(
    user_no number not null,
    user_id varchar2(30) constraint user_id_pk primary key,
    user_pwd char(20)
);

 

테이블 상태

 

1. 컬럼 추가하기

alter table member_table add(user_name varchar2(20));

member_table 테이블에 user_name 이라는 컬럼을 추가하고, varchar2(20) 자료형으로 설정한다.

 

테이블 상태

user_name 컬럼이 추가되었다.

 

 

 

2. 컬럼명 수정하기

alter table member_table rename column user_pwd to password;

 

테이블 상태

 

 

 

3. 컬럼의 자료형 수정

alter table member_table modify user_name char(10) modify password varchar2(20);

테이블 상태

 

 

 

4. 컬럼의 삭제

alter table member_table drop (user_name);

테이블 상태

user_name 컬럼이 다시 삭제되었다.

 

 

 

 

 

 

댓글